"At their milestone high school reunion, a group of friends makes a pact to finally achieve their high school superlatives one way or another in this lively new novel from the acclaimed author of Last Summer at the Golden Hotel. In 1997, grunge is king, Titanic is a blockbuster (and Blockbuster still exists), and Thursday nights are for Friends. In Bellport, Connecticut, four best friends and high school seniors are ready to light the world on fire. Melissa Levin, Priya Chowdhury, Tara Taylor, and Suki Hammer are going places. Their yearbook superlatives confirm it: Most Likely to Win the White House, Cure Cancer, Open a Michelin-Starred Restaurant, and Join the Forbes 400. Fast-forward twenty-five years and nothing has gone according to plan as the women regroup at their dreaded high school reunion. When a forgotten classmate emerges at the reunion with a surprising announcement, the friends dig out the yearbook and rethink their younger selves. Is it too late to make their dreams come true? Fueled by nostalgia and one too many drinks, they form a pact to push through their middle-aged angst to bring their teenage aspirations to fruition, dubbing themselves the "Most Likely Girls." Through the ensuing highs and lows, they are reminded of the enduring bonds of friendship and the ways our childhood dreams both sustain and surprise us-and why it's deeply uncool to peak in high school"--… (meer)

What a relief when I made the decision at page 120 to stop reading. I really didn’t like this book – the characters, their values (or lack of them), the predictable plot, the language and the sex. I couldn’t believe it was written by the same author who wrote Last Summer at the Golden Hotel, which I enjoyed and gave 5 stars.

I can’t recommend this one. Don’t waste your time. ( )

If you enjoy reading about four frustrated middle-aged women who are disappointed that life failed to turn out the way they had expected back in high school and love creating drama between not only themselves, but everyone around them, even when none exists, then this book might be for you. For me, it was just “meh.” I can live without reading about diva drama.

I wanted to like this book, but it was highly disappointing. The characters were flat and the dialogue stilted and unrealistic. None of them achieved any of the goals they set for themselves in high school, but who does, really. Life has a way of changing our path as we age and most of us choose a different path than what we were on when we were in our teens.

These women were more interested in fulfilling their yearbook superlatives than nurturing their children and their marriages, all of whom were in disrepair, so it was no wonder none of them possessed a happy home relationship.

The “fairy tale” plot of the rich alum that no one could barely remember returning to his high school to not only make a generous donation, but to fall in love with the most dysfunctional of these women was too much to accept as a reader.

I can summarize the book in two words, Diva Drama. I don’t care to read about it. ( )
